Prizemoney Increased For Yass Picnic Races

Please be advised of the increase in prizemoney to all races at this meeting on Saturday 25 February.

The new prizemoney levels are:

Yass Picnic Cup** (1400m) $5000 to $6000 Trophy Handicap (1100m) $3000 to $4500 Class 3 Trophy Handicap (900m) $2500 to $3500 Class B Handicap (1200m) $2500 to $3500 Maiden Plate (900m) $2500 to $3000 Maiden Plate (1200m) $2500 to $3000

** Please note the Yass Picnic Cup is no longer a Trophy Handicap as it exceeds the prizemoney restriction.
